GIS Technician

Austin Utilities is seeking a talented and self-driven GIS Technician to join our Engineering Services team. The successful candidate will be responsible for developing, operating, and maintaining the GIS system for the water, natural gas, electric, and fiber-optic utilities. Responsible for GIS program planning, coordination, GIS mapping, database management, and application development. Prepares drawings, recording and filing of engineering documentation, required in-field location of buried utilities, routine and complex technical engineering related work in the areas of water, natural gas, electric and fiber optics lines, distribution system components and utility facilities in the office and in the field.

Key respon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Develop, operate, and maintain a GIS system for the water, natural gas, electric, and fiber-optic utilities.
  • Performs routine and complex technical engineering related work in the planning and recording of water, natural gas, and electric utility infrastructure.

What will it take to be successful?

  • The ideal candidate will have graduated from an accredited technical or community college in in Geographic Information Systems (GIS) or related field such as Geography, Engineering Technology, Civil Engineering, Computer Science with an emphasis in GIS coursework and training and minimum of two years full-time experience with GIS mapping and database management using ESRI ArcGIS software or its equivalent for a municipal or utility type application; or any equivalent combination of education and experience;
  • Possess a current and valid driver's license.
  • Submit to random drug testing requirements.
